Nelle turned a year older, and we celebrated quietly but sweetly. I baked the birthday cake with help from Linna.

She was so proud to help, and the cake turned out lovely. We lit the candles, sang the birthday song, and smiled at how quickly these little ones grow.


It was one of those rare moments when both of Nelle’s godparents were with us. Life gets busy, so having them both here on her special day meant a lot.


When the rain finally stopped, we enjoyed a lovely time outside, grilling šašlik and soaking in the fresh, earthy air.

Meanwhile, the grandparents enjoyed a quiet moment in the sauna and hot bath —Latvian style.

Not everything was perfect or posed, but the day was real, warm, and full of love.
Tired but happy after sauna, šašlik, and a full day of fun, the girls made their way to a sleepover at the grandparents’ house.



We continued the celebration the next morning with a late breakfast, and some friends kept the party spirit going well into the following day as well! So the last one left us today 🙂
